Hey — welcome aboard! Quick handover on dependency pinning for the Quillbase repos: we pin everything, exact versions, no ranges. Renewals go through the Lockstep bot every other Tuesday; don't hand-edit lockfiles or Davenne will haunt you. Exceptions need a note in the pinning registry with a reason. To approve bot PRs you'll need access to the Cobblevault signing store, which asks for the team recovery passphrase on first login. Here it is:

strongbox words: zorox-holix

**Capacity note: per-tenant quotas on Hollowgate**

Quick heads-up before the cut: Hollowgate's per-tenant rate quotas are getting tight as the Brindlemark migration lands. We've got maybe 30% headroom on the busiest shard, less during the morning spike. I'd rather bump quotas deliberately than firefight later, so let's lock these in for the release. Here's what I'm proposing we ship as the new defaults.

constants for bawif-kawif:
QUOTAS = {
    "ulaael": 5,
    "holael": 10,
}

Subject: DR drill Thursday — pricing experiment data included this time

Hey Priya,

Quick heads-up before Thursday's disaster-recovery drill: we're including the Fanfare ticket-pricing experiment tables in the restore scope this round. Last drill we skipped them and the variant assignments came back stale, which made the analytics folks grumpy. Plan for an extra ten minutes on the restore step. You'll run the failover from the Larkspur console as usual. When prompted at the vault step, use the recovery passphrase below.

Thanks,
Dario

unlock words, yawig-kagef: gordor-holvan-ulaael-pramir-ulaiel-tamdor

## Break-Glass Access: Ratewatch Parity Checker

If the Ratewatch admin console is unreachable and a hotel partner reports stale parity data, support may invoke break-glass access. This bypasses normal approval and is logged to the audit channel automatically. Use it only when both primary on-call engineers are unavailable. Document your reason in the incident thread first. Then unlock the emergency console with the passphrase below.

vault phrase of yagag-yafof = belael-weniel-kasion-silath-jorax-pelox-silir-soreth-ralmir